The Lottery Winners Whose Lives Changed Overnight

What Happened, Where It Happened, and When the Win Was Reported

In 2016, a record-breaking $1.6 billion Powerball jackpot was won by three people in California, Florida, and Tennessee. News outlets reported these wins quickly, turning ordinary people into millionaires overnight. This strange fortune caught the nation’s attention, showing that luck can strike anyone, anytime.

FAQ

What exactly defines “weird wealth” in the American context?

Weird wealth means getting rich in unusual ways, not just through jobs. It includes big lottery wins, unexpected inheritances, and hits like the Pet Rock. It’s about fortunes that change lives quickly or through unique business ideas.

How do reporters verify stories of strange fortune to avoid spreading rumors?

Journalists use public records and financial documents to check facts. For example, they look at property deeds and bankruptcy filings for stories like The One in Bel Air. This way, they make sure reports are true, not just social media rumors.

Can a simple household product really lead to eccentric affluence?

Yes! Simple items can turn into big fortunes. Ty Warner made Beanie Babies a hit, leading to wealth and luxury buys. Luck, timing, and patents can make basic ideas into big money.
